C++
Required Qualifications
Strong proficiency in C++
Solid understanding of object-oriented programming (OOP) principles.
Experience with data structures, algorithms, and design patterns.
Experience with version control systems (e.g., Git).
Strong problem-solving and analytical skills.
Excellent communication and teamwork abilities.
A Bachelor's or Master's degree in Computer Science or a related field is preferred
Preferred Qualifications
Experience with Build Systems such as CMake or Bazel
Experience with Continuous Integration or Continuous Deployment pipelines
Prior experience successfully completing a large scale code migration or refactoring project
Skills Required
Continuous Integration, Algorithms, Continuous Deployment, Design Patterns, Data Structures
Architect • India